Purple Style Labs Launches ₹680 Crore IPO On August 31
Purple Style Labs, parent of Pernia's Pop-Up Shop, launches IPO. Issue size: ₹680 crore.

Purple Style Labs Ltd, the parent company of Pernia's Pop-Up Shop, is set to launch its Initial Public Offering (IPO) on August 31. The three-day offering will conclude on September 2, with the bidding for anchor investors opening on August 28.
The company has filed its Updated Draft Red Herring Prospectus (UDRHP) with markets regulator Sebi and received approval for the IPO in January this year. The IPO is entirely a fresh issue of equity shares, with no Offer For Sale (OFS) component.
Purple Style Labs plans to utilize ₹371.13 crore of the IPO proceeds for investment in its wholly-owned subsidiary, PSL Retail, and ₹138.90 crore towards sales and marketing expenses. The balance will be used for general corporate purposes.
The proposed IPO marks Purple Style Labs' debut in the public markets, coming at a time when India's wedding and luxury consumption markets are witnessing strong growth. The country's wedding industry has crossed ₹10 lakh crore, while the wedding-wear segment is projected to reach ₹3.4 lakh crore by FY30.
Purple Style Labs is promoted by Abhishek Agarwal, who holds a 27.10 per cent stake in the company. The company is backed by institutional investors, family offices, and private investors, including celebrity investors such as Shah Rukh Khan, Salman Khan, and Sachin Tendulkar.
Pernia's Pop-Up Shop currently offers over 2 lakh products from over 1,300 designers through its digital platform and 14 experience centres. The company is expanding its retail presence, including its flagship Pernia's Pop-Up Studio at Fort in Mumbai and an experience centre on Linking Road in Mumbai.
Axis Capital Ltd and IIFL Capital Services Ltd are the bankers to the issue. With the IPO, Purple Style Labs aims to strengthen its position in the luxury fashion market and expand its operations.
